Page 6: Science

Metals: shiny, good conductors of heat and electricity, have a high a high density

Non metals: Their surface is dull and they are poor conductor of heat and electricity

Metalloids: an element that has both metallic and nonmetallic properties, as arsenic, silicon, or boron.

Page 18: Science

THE UNIVERSE

In space there are rock called asteroids. Asteroids are small Solar System bodies in orbit around the Sun. they are smaller than planets but larger than meteoroids. A meteoroid is a sand- to boulder-sized particle of debris in the Solar System. The visible path of a meteoroid that enters Earth's(or another body's) atmosphere is called a meteor, or colloquially a shooting star or falling star. If a meteor reaches the ground and survives impact, then it is called a meteorite. Many meteors appearing seconds or minutes apart are called a meteor shower. The root word meteor comes from the Greek meteōros, meaning "high in the air".
